Litopenaeus vannameiis one of the three majorcultured shrimps in the worldbecause of its fast growth rate,high flesh content,delicious taste and strong disease resistance.Macrobrachium rosenbergiiis one of the main freshwater shrimp in China because of its fast growth,less diseases,large body type and delicious taste.Researching on the muscle nutrients of Litopenaeus vannamei and Macrobrachium rosenbergii in different growth stagesfrom March to September 2017,Haifeng Aquaculture Professional Cooperative in Fengxian District,Shanghai,and Haocheng Aquaculture Professional Cooperative in Fengxian District,Shanghai from April to October 2018.The aims were to explore the nutritional value of shrimp muscles in different growth stages,and provided a theoretical reference for farmers to improve feed and shrimp quality during feeding.The Haifeng Aquaculture Cooperative mainly cultivated Litopenaeus vannamei,which was bred 2 times a year.The first carp(March-June 2017)was greenhouse farming,and the second carp(June-September 2017)was outdoor breeding,Haocheng Aquaculture Cooperative farmed Macrobrachium rosenbergii.After the shrimps were desalinated,the shrimp samples were collected every 20 days until the shrimps in the test ponds were arrested.The nutrients of the collected shrimp muscles were determined,including water,crude protein,crude fat,crude ash,amino acids and fatty acids,and the main results were as followed:1.Under the Greenhouse culture and outdoor culture mode,the contents of crude protein,crude fat and ash in shrimp muscles showed no obvious difference between Litopenaeus vannamei in similar growth phases.Considering the crude protein content,the Litopenaeus vannamei was more nutritious when grown for 40 d..Under the greenhouse culture mode,the unsaturated fatty acids of Litopenaeus vannamei at 40 d,60 d,74 d and 94 d accounted for 64.46%,60.97%,62.47% and 63.16% of the total fatty acid content,respectively.Under the outdoor culture mode,the unsaturated fatty acid contents of Litopenaeus vannamei at 40 d,60 d,80 d and 95 d accounted for 67.69%,64.74%,65.35% and 65.63% of the total fatty acid content,respectively.The muscles of Litopenaeus vannamei were rich in unsaturated fatty acids under the two cultivation modes,and the polyunsaturated fatty acids of Litopenaeus vannamei in the similar growth stage under the greenhouse cultivation mode were significantly lower than that in the outdoor cultivation mode.Considering the content of polyunsaturated fatty acids,both the greenhouse and the outdoor culture of the shrimps were more nutritious when the shrimps grew for 40 days.,and the outdoor culture was better than the greenhouse one.The amino acids composition in greenhouse cultured and outdoor cultured Litopenaeus vannameiin similar growth stages were consistent,which contained 17 kinds of amino acids.When Litopenaeus vannameigrew to 40 d,60 d,80 d and 95 d in the greenhouse culture mode,ΣEAA/ΣAA ratios were 29.36%,30.71%,33.28%,32.91% and ΣEAA/ΣNEAA ratios were 0.04%,55.63%,63.14%,60.56%.When Litopenaeus vannamei grew to 40 d,60 d,80 d and 95 d in the outdoor culture mode,ΣEAA/ΣAA ratios were 34.70%,33.69%,32.93%,34.11%,ΣEAA/ΣNEAA ratios were 64.44%,63.72%,62.66%,66.76%,which basically conformed to the FAO/WHO ideal model.The total amount of amino acids,essential amino acids and delicious amino acids in outdoor cultured Litopenaeus vannameiwere higher than that cultured in greenhouse.Conclusions were as followed: Greenhouse cultured and outdoor cultured Litopenaeus vannamei was a kind of shrimp which had high protein,low fat and high nutritional value.From the perspective of protein nutrition,the last growth phase of greenhouse cultured and outdoor cultured Litopenaeus vannamei had higher nutritional value,and the nutritional quality of outdoor cultured Litopenaeus vannamei was better than that of greenhouse cultured one.2.The contents of crude protein,crude fat and ash in muscles showed no obvious difference betweenMacrobrachium rosenbergii in different growth phases.From the crude protein content,the growth of Macrobrachium rosenbergii at 60 d was more nutritious..The total poly-unsaturated fatty acid contents of Macrobrachium rosenbergii at 61 d,81 d,102 d,123 d,143 d and 164 d accounted for 55.72%,54.68%,52.23%,49.48%,48.68% and 45.28% of the total fatty acid content,respectively;EPA+DHA contents of Macrobrachium rosenbergii accounted for 28.86%,29.17%,23.31%,21.26%,20.19% and 20.49% of the total fatty acid content,respectively,the contents gradually decreased with the growth of the shrimp.Considering the content of poly-unsaturated fatty acids,Macrobrachium rosenbergiiwas more nutritious when they grew for 61 days..The amino acids composition in Macrobrachium rosenbergii different growth stages were consistent,which contained 17 kinds of amino acids,and the highest glutamic acid content was obtained.When Macrobrachium rosenbergii grew to 61 d,81 d,102 d,123 d,143 d and 164 d,ΣEAA/ΣAA ratios were 32.87%,30.23%,32.76%,33.07%,33.77%,34.82% and ΣEAA/ΣNEAA ratios were 60.20%,54.01%,61.91%,63.40%,65.93%,69.57%,which basically conformed to the FAO/WHO ideal model.From the perspective of protein nutrition,the nutritional value of Macrobrachium rosenbergii growing from 102 d to 164 d was higher.
